&NA;Caregivers for individuals suffering from severe or terminal progressive degenerative dementia must consider the irreversible nature of this condition and adjust appropriately the treatment strategies. Maintaining or enhancing the quality of life should be a goal of care even in advanced dementia. This goal requires attention to the availability of meaningful activities, appropriate management of simultaneous infections and eating difficulties, and effective treatment of behavioral symptoms of dementia. Providing care on a special care unit (SCU) has advantages over care on traditional nursing home units. Advance directives should be formulated as soon as possible to guide end‐of‐life care of each individual with dementia.
